THE 5-SECOND TRICK FOR DATA STRUCTURE AND ALGORITHM IN C#

The 5-Second Trick For data structure and algorithm in c#

The 5-Second Trick For data structure and algorithm in c#

Blog Article

It is useful in fields which include social community Assessment, suggestion programs, and Computer system networks. In the sphere of sports data science, graph data structure can be employed to analyze and realize the dynamics of

This repository is paired which has a Udemy Program that teaches all the algorithms and data structures executed below with animated functions about the identical examples shown by means of this repository's device tests, and images.

Often immutable collection varieties are less performant but supply immutability - and that is often a sound comparative gain.

Makes use of a hash desk as its inner data structure for effective storage and retrieval of key-price pairs.

A BitArray is really a Particular scenario; its ability is the same as its length, which can be the same as its count.

All the public strategies have summaries and comprehensive comments to elucidate the in excess of all performance and the logic at the rear of Just about every intricate line of code.

This course concentrates not just at algorithms and data structures normally nonetheless it uncovers the internals of data structures and algorithms created-in .Internet BCL (.Internet Core’s BCL is the same regarding fundamental data structures and algorithms)

Obvious and Concise Code: Every data structure and algorithm is carried out in C# with a target readability and simplicity.

I'm thankful enough for that I really like what I do. I began my career like a postgraduate scholar taking part in Microsoft ImagineCup contest. I have been working with .Internet platform because 2003. I've been professionally architecting and applying application for data structure and algorithm in c# nearly seven many years, largely dependant on .

Hunting within a binary look for tree has the complexity of time O(log n) , example of hunting in binary tree:

Definition: Binary search can be an productive algorithm that works on sorted arrays by continuously dividing the research interval in 50 percent.

Introduction to Algorithms and Data Structures: what exactly is a data structure, summary data form and what’s the difference between these notions. What is an algorithm and why they are very important to us?

This class presents fundamental and Sophisticated insights into sorting and looking algorithms. It walks by means of a variety of algorithms' sorts and functionalities, complexity Investigation, and realistic apps in advanced challenge-fixing.

The new C# implementation code, employing a modular programming fashion, offers the actual code with the algorithm.

Report this page